Tuyil Is Still In Kwara, No New Tax Imposed - KWIRS

Date: 2016-08-31

As against the rumour being spread by the enemies of Kwara state that one of the leading pharmaceutical industries in Nigeria, Tuyil Pharmacy, has relocated from Kwara State owing to a high taxes by Kwara state government, here is the response of the Kwara Internal Revenue Service's Director of Administration and Corporate Affairs, Mrs. Adenike Babajamu to the rumoured exit of not only Tuyil Pharmaceutical Company but also Coca-cola Company.

"With due respect and to set the records straight. We must as a matter of fact verify rumors and confirm the source of all information. I work with the new Revenue Agency and I want to confirm in very strong language that No new Tax has been imposed on Tuyil nor any corporate body in KWARA State. We have a very cordial relationship with the MD Tuyil Pharmaceutical Industry and if you visit the Company office, you will see new structures under construction. A company leaving town because of tax burden will not invest in the same company. Please visit our website www.kw-Irs.com for details of our activities.

As for Coca-Cola leaving town because of tax, this also is false.
